Course Topics
The program focuses on four integrated units that cover everything you need to start as a professional in facility management:
1- Operations and Maintenance
Operations and maintenance are key pillars of facility management, where buildings, systems, and equipment are periodically assessed to ensure their continued efficiency. This includes managing preventive maintenance and daily operations to minimize unexpected failures and improve performance. Additionally, the trainee learns how to select service providers, manage contracts, and monitor performance to ensure high quality and appropriate costs.
2- Project Management
In this part, the trainee learns about facility management projects and the role of the project manager in overseeing them. They acquire skills in project planning from initiation to execution in a professional manner that guarantees the achievement of the desired goals. The process doesn't stop at execution but also includes project closure and final results evaluation to measure success and identify areas for improvement.
3- Finance and Business
This module focuses on the financial and administrative aspects of facility management. It covers the basics of financial management and accounting related to buildings and services. Participants are trained to prepare budgets and analyze financial data, enabling them to make informed decisions. The module also discusses contract management, procurement, and outsourcing in a way that balances efficiency with cost.
4- Leadership and Strategy
Facility management cannot be complete without effective leadership and a clear vision. In this module, participants learn how to develop a strategic plan for facility management that aligns with the organization's goals. The training also focuses on enhancing leadership skills and influencing in the workplace, contributing to better results. Additionally, the program covers how to build effective teams and professionally resolve conflicts, which enhances collaboration and organizational success.
